On the design of structural funding for the whole of Germany: Requirements from an East German perspective

Now that the dispute over the future shape of federal-state financial relations seems to have been settled, at least for the time being, following the compromise reached between the federal government and the states in October, another issue is coming to the fore, namely how the "pan-German structural assistance" for economically weak regions agreed in the coalition agreement of the federal government is to be implemented. When the current EU Structural Fund funding period expires in 2020 at the latest, it will be necessary to redefine the regional development areas in Germany.
